Abstract

This study aimed to obtain information about the public perception of the effect of supporting the infrastructure development of the unique nature of Lake Batur Lake Batur, in the district of Kintamani, Bangli regency of Bali Province. This study used survey method with descriptive quantitative approach. Collecting data using the questionnaire technique. The data analysis technique used is the test requirements analysis, simple linear regression analysis with a sample of 20 people (10 women and 10 men). The result is the development of supporting infrastructure implemented in the ecotourism object of Lake Batur in harmony with the natural beauty of Lake Batur. This can be seen from the opinions and perceptions of visitors who say that the uniqueness of Lake Batur nature is maintained and still can be enjoyed from the first until now.
 According Deputy for Tourism Destination Development and Investment of the Ministry of Tourism, 2016 for tourist visit to Indonesia, there are 3 kinds of products that interest are Natural (nature) 35%, Culture 60% and Man Made 5%. Lake Batur is a product for tourism objects that combine natural products and cultural products. One thing that can not be separated from the existence of Mount Batur is Lake Batur. Lake Batur is located in the District Kitamani, Bangli regency, is the largest lake on the island of Bali. Data on the potential of natural resources in a volcano ecosystem as a whole and comprehensive is important to know as the basis for making sustainable development planning.
